District Court New South Wales
Medium Neutral Citation: R v Beaver [2019] NSWDC 215 Hearing dates: 16 April 2019 Date of orders: 16 April 2019 Decision date: 16 April 2019 Jurisdiction: Criminal Before: Hunt DCJ Decision: The offender is sentenced to an aggregate term of imprisonment for a period of 7 years with a non parole period of 4 years
For the matter on the s166 certificate of contravene ADVO the offender is sentenced to a fixed term of imprisonment for a period of 12 months which is wholly concurrent with the aggregate sentence. Catchwords: CRIMINAL LAW – Sentence – Form 1 – S 166 certificate – Offender on parole at time of offending – Breach of ADVO – Assault occasioning actual bodily harm – Common assault - Armed with intent to commit an indictable offence - Intimidation - Victim in fear – Do act to influence a witness – Escape police custody Legislation Cited: Crimes Act Crimes (Domestic and Personal Violence) Act Crimes (Sentencing Procedure) Act.
